if you’re going according to the Word, it says to not forsake assembling together with other Believers i.e. church, cause there is strength gained from a corporate setting of faith and power that comes when you gather together to fellowship that way. with that being said, i think the face of church as usual is changing though. i think God is moving in ways in addition to traditional church settings as well. the church is moving from the four walls to things like the internet, in home groups and other types of gatherings. as Christians we are the church. the thing is to understand the concept of church and differentiate between the corporate gathering as a means to learn, fellowship, and get taught the Word vs. BEING the church or the Body of Christ, which operates in the power. the five-fold ministry was established for a reason, so we do need to come together to be taught the Word, edified, corrected, etc. but then you have to take that knowledge out of the four walls and allow it to impact the world. that’s what real church is.
